- Surface airspace
-
Class D
Two-way radio communication must be established before you enter, while the tower is open.
The same callsign rule as Class C. When the tower closes the airspace usually reverts to Class E, or to Class G where no surface area is charted — the Chart Supplement entry says which, and the hours are on the sectional. A surface area normally extends to 2,500 ft above the field, with the ceiling charted in a dashed blue box as a number in hundreds of feet.
